Overview
This contract framework is for the provision of Dental Sundries for NHSS Health Boards including the following commodity groups; Consumables, Standard Endodontics, Finishing and Polishing, General Hygiene, Hand Instruments, Hand Pieces, Impressions, Linings and Cements, Matrix Systems, Oral Hygiene, Pins & Posts, Prevention, Restoratives, Rotary Instruments, Surgical, Temporary Crowns and Materials. For NHSS Hospital locations. General Dental Practitioners (GDPs) are not in scope for this framework. All products are supplied directly to the individual Health Boards across Scotland.
